Is Avon Lake or Merrimack Safer?

According to crimebycity.com's analysis of 2024 FBI data, Avon Lake is safer than Merrimack (Safety Score 98/100 vs 97/100), with a total crime rate of 310 per 100,000 versus 344 for Merrimack — 10% lower. Avon Lake has higher rates in 2 of 5 crime categories.

The biggest difference is in violent crime, where Merrimack has a 100% lower rate.

Detailed Crime Rate Comparison

Crime Type Avon Lake Merrimack Difference
Total Crime Rate 309.6 344.0 -34.5
Violent Crime Rate 19.1 0.0 +19.1
Murder Rate 0.0 0.0 +0.0
Rape Rate 3.8 0.0 +3.8
Robbery Rate 0.0 0.0 +0.0
Aggravated Assault Rate 15.3 0.0 +15.3
Property Crime Rate 290.4 344.0 -53.6
Burglary Rate 45.9 13.5 +32.4
Larceny-Theft Rate 225.5 313.7 -88.2
Motor Vehicle Theft Rate 19.1 16.9 +2.3

All rates per 100,000 residents. Source: FBI UCR 2024.

About Avon Lake, OH

Avon Lake, a lakeside community west of Cleveland, was once home to the world's largest coal-fired power plant. This affluent suburb along Lake Erie boasts a picturesque shoreline and a population of over 25,000. With a safety score of 98/100 and a population coverage of 26,167, Avon Lake has a total crime rate of 309.6 per 100,000 residents.

About Merrimack, NH

Merrimack, a town bisected by the Merrimack River, was once home to the historic Reeds Ferry lumber industry. Today, it's a suburban community in Hillsborough County with a population of about 27,000. With a safety score of 97/100 and a population coverage of 29,650, Merrimack has a total crime rate of 344.0 per 100,000 residents.
